Handover for the weekly eng sync: I'm transferring ownership of Duskrunner, our nightly backfill scheduler, to Priya. Current state: all jobs healthy except the ledger-reconciliation backfill, which retries once nightly due to a slow upstream from the Kestwick warehouse. Retry logic, window sizing, and concurrency caps were all tuned carefully last quarter — please don't change them without a load test. For full transparency at the sync, the production instance runs with these configuration values.

settings of hawep-kadug:
RALAEL_HOST=ralael.tolvaqlabs.internal
RALAEL_PORT=9000

Slimming job for the Querrel base image failed at the strip stage — multi-arch layer mismatch after the Tovan toolchain bump. Pinned the builder image, re-ran, size back under target (41 MB). No runtime deltas in smoke tests. Safe to promote. Reference build follows.

build token for tahop-fafof: htk14_2d55df8101eccc

Subject: Wiki RBAC cut-over complete

Welcome aboard. Over the weekend we migrated the Fernwick wiki to role-based access. Contractors now get the "external-editor" role by default, which covers page edits but not space administration. Old per-page ACLs were converted automatically; report any access gaps to the platform channel. The access service now runs with the following configuration values.

deployment values, bahof-badug:
[rusix]
team = zorok
access_code = ac_641cbe
owner = ulair.tamius
host = rusix.torvasoft.local
port = 5672
peer = ulaix.sivrelworks.internal
salt = 1df570ed
pin = 6327

## Further reading

Doclint-Marn is our documentation linter; it checks heading structure, stale code samples, and broken cross-references in every merge request. Most rules are auto-fixable with the --repair flag, and the weekly sync is the right place to propose new rules or exemptions. Rule IDs map one-to-one to config keys, so disabling a check is a single-line change. The complete rule catalog, exemption process, and changelog are kept on the internal page below.

operations page: https://jenkins.zemvarcloud.local/job/merge_requests/repo/build/73930b4b30f0a8ed